Default W516 with text at top

I picked up this card because it says, "Catching Cards" at the top. There is a W516 on ebay that says "Universal". Are these from an ad poster? Any info on these? Also, post any W516 that you have here... Thanks

Default Re: W516 with text at top

I think those captions refer to the manufacturer. The missing letter is an "m", for matching. Examples are not rare, but more difficult than those without. I suspect the captions were printed only on the top of the sheet, so that the lower horizontal strips would not have them.

Definitely not a popular set, and not a favorite of mine either. Ed is correct about the print on top...I know at sometime in the past I have seen the whole sentence. Here are a couple of mine W516's, one with the 'Universal' part of the statement, and the first set of quotation marks, and the Bancroft with interesting name on top and bottom, which doesn't make much sense to me, being that it was a strip set, unless it was a sheet that just contained the same horizontal strip of ten.
